Fish tracking project builds the case for international conservation cooperation. The stingray was tagged with a tracking device and returned to the Mekong River, where its movements are informing conservation planning. In June 2022, fishers in Cambodia caught a giant freshwater stingray weighing 661 pounds (300 kilos).
